Core responsibilities
This role supports teachers by assisting students struggling with focus in the classroom and supervising them during transitions and in the anchor room, where reflection on behavior management occurs. The specialist also monitors student assignments, provides instructional assistance, and refers serious behavior problems to the school administrator.
Requirements summary
Candidates must possess strong interpersonal and organizational skills, with the ability to communicate effectively both orally and in writing, and work cooperatively. Eligibility requires at least 60 college hours or an associate’s degree or higher, with prior experience as a teacher, assistant, or paraprofessional being preferred.
